As for the flashing "your fuel tank is emptying soon" sign, I will not try again. The last time I did, cold sweat broke out on me and my wife. Was on AYE after Outram exit when the sign started to flash. The next thing I know, the air-inlet begin to give out a slightly burnt smell (could had been the road, but you know lah, once you get nervous...) I have to switch off the air-con, wind down my windows and make sure I did not go above 2500 rpm.

 

It lasted me to the Corporation Road exit (to the Shell station there). Then I pumped 32 litres of RON92 (so, it is correct, when 8 litres left, the bloody sign will flash). So confirm can last you till the next petrol station, when you are in Singapore. If you go up north, can you give us the verdict? [sweatdrop]

hey Komson!, as for sound proofing infor:

each door need one sp sheet, cost around $40-$50

wheel arch area, cost around $20-$30

 

whole floor span deck area need around eight sp sheet cost around $400-$500

front fire wall area need to do well, to get max result.

all price should inclusive installation..

the noise reduction improve like about 50%-70%

(especially the highway road noise...improve alot)

but the end u will suffer addional weight of about 25kg..fc go up abit lol.

 

 

well...as for mi, my car got additional of 50kg
